Exploring Agentic AI: The Future
Artificial Intelligence (AI) has been rapidly transforming industries with its ability to automate tasks, analyze large datasets, and learn from experiences. A burgeoning subfield within AI, known as Agentic AI, is gaining attention for its potential to revolutionize how systems operate by endowing them with more agency than ever before.
Agentic AI refers to artificial intelligence systems that possess the ability to make autonomous decisions using a combination of internal goals and perceptions of their environment. Unlike traditional AI models that primarily operate based on pre-programmed instructions and data, Agentic AI is designed to perceive, decide, and act independently, often adjusting its strategies based on evolving circumstances.

While the potential of Agentic AI is vast, it also raises critical questions and challenges. These include ensuring ethical decision-making, safeguarding against system errors, and addressing privacy concerns. As these technologies advance, it becomes imperative for developers, policymakers, and ethicists to create guidelines that ensure the beneficial development and integration of Agentic AI.
Agentic AI represents a significant leap in artificial intelligence, offering systems that not only simulate human-like autonomy but also outperform traditional AI in complex, dynamic environments. As research and development continue, Agentic AI promises to create smarter, more responsive systems that can profoundly impact various sectors of society. However, it is essential to address its challenges proactively to harness its full potential responsibly.
